Year-Long Program II

Work at a more advanced level, while maintaining the “beginner’s mind” so essential to this process. Design your year to meet individual goals. Bring a quandary or a question. Experiment with the practice. Explore new applications. Examine important issues, such as: power dynamics, diverse modes of perception, and working in various contexts/environments.

Year-Long Program II provides six weekends of retreat, practice and study. It offers community, mentoring and choice. It invites each person to design his or her year to meet individual needs and goals. It offers new themes, new questions, and an opportunity to work at an advanced level, while maintaining the “beginner’s mind” so essential to this process.

We will examine issues important to the practice — power dynamics, working in various contexts/environments, and the “chest of drawers” of ways to respond. As in Year-Long Program I each weekend will have a different theme, such as: The Chest of Drawers; Dreams; Transference and Power; The Senses, Sensuality and Sexuality; Body and World; Life Stages and Endings. The weekends will include movement sessions, labs examining the witnessing relationship, dialogue about the readings, experiments with the practice, and time to bring questions/share experiences in the process. Participants may, for example, present a case study, bring a quandary or question from their practice outside this workshop, or explore new applications.
